首页 > 要闻简讯 > 精选范文 >

EXCEL中的表格行变列列变行

2025-06-03 23:56:30

问题描述:

EXCEL中的表格行变列列变行,在线求解答

最佳答案

推荐答案

2025-06-03 23:56:30

在日常的数据处理工作中,Excel作为一款强大的工具,常常需要我们对数据进行各种灵活的调整和转换。其中,“行变列,列变行”这一操作尤为常见,尤其是在数据分析和报告整理时。本文将详细介绍如何在Excel中实现这一功能,帮助您更高效地完成数据处理任务。

首先,让我们明确什么是“行变列,列变行”。简单来说,就是将原本横向排列的数据转换为纵向排列,或者反过来,将纵向的数据转为横向。这种操作通常被称为“转置”。

方法一:使用复制粘贴功能

这是最直观的方法之一。假设您有一组数据,需要将其从行转换为列:

1. 选中您想要转换的数据区域。

2. 右键点击选中的区域,在弹出的菜单中选择“复制”或按下快捷键Ctrl+C。

3. 选择一个空白单元格作为目标位置。

4. 再次右键点击目标位置,在弹出的菜单中选择“粘贴特殊”。

5. 在弹出的对话框中勾选“转置”,然后点击“确定”。

这样,您的数据就会从行变为列,或者从列变为行。

方法二:使用公式

如果您希望保留原始数据,并且需要动态地实现行变列或列变行,可以使用Excel的数组公式。例如,假设A1:A3是您的原始数据:

1. 在B1单元格输入公式 `=TRANSPOSE(A1:A3)`。

2. 按下Ctrl+Shift+Enter(而不是普通的Enter),因为这是一个数组公式。

这样,您就可以在B1:C1看到原始数据的转置结果。

方法三:使用Power Query

对于更复杂的数据集,Power Query是一个非常强大的工具。它可以帮助您轻松地实现数据的行列转换:

1. 选择您的数据区域,然后点击“数据”选项卡中的“从表/范围”。

2. 在弹出的窗口中确认数据范围并点击“确定”。

3. 在Power Query编辑器中,选择“转换”选项卡,然后点击“转置”。

4. 最后,点击“关闭并加载”,将转换后的数据加载回Excel。

通过以上三种方法,您可以根据具体需求选择最适合的方式来实现“行变列,列变行”的操作。无论是简单的数据调整还是复杂的多步骤处理,Excel都能为您提供强大的支持。

希望这篇文章能帮助您更好地掌握这一技能,并在实际工作中提高效率!

---

希望这篇文章符合您的需求!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。